#155273 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#155273 is composed of 8.2% red, 32.2%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.7% cyan, 28.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 201.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 26.7%. #155273 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aa4e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#155273 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#155273 has RGB values of R:21, G:82,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 1397363.

Shades and Tints of #155273
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b0f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#155273
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f4649 is the less saturated color, while #005888 is the most saturated one.
